Flood Matters. If at any time owned real property is pledged as collateral hereunder, (A) the Borrower shall provide at least forty-five (45) days’ prior written notice to the pledge of such real property as collateral, (B) the Borrower shall provide (1) standard flood hazard determination forms and (2) if any property is located in a special flood hazard area, (x) notices to (and confirmations of receipt by) the Borrower as to the existence of a special flood hazard and, if applicable, the unavailability of flood hazard insurance under the National Flood Insurance Program and (y) evidence of applicable flood insurance, if available, in each case in such form, on such terms and in such amounts as required by The National Flood Insurance Reform Act of 1994, the Federal Flood Disaster Protection Act and rules and regulations promulgated thereunder or as otherwise required by the Administrative Agent or any Lender, and (C) the Administrative Agent shall not enter into, accept or record any mortgage in respect of such real property until the Administrative Agent shall have received written confirmation from each Lender that flood insurance compliance has been completed by such Lender with respect to such real property (such written confirmation not to be unreasonably withheld or delayed). Any increase, extension or renewal of this Agreement shall be subject to flood insurance due diligence and flood insurance compliance reasonably satisfactory to the Administrative Agent and each Lender.
